Maintenance Planner Responsibilities and Duties
Develop and maintain detailed maintenance schedules, balancing preventive, predictive, and corrective maintenance activities. Prioritize and plan work orders based on urgency, production requirements, and resource availability. Ensure that maintenance activities are planned with minimal disruption to production. Coordinate planned maintenance with production schedules to maximize equipment uptime. Create, review, and assign maintenance work orders in the Computerized Maintenance Management System (CMMS). Ensure all necessary materials, tools, and spare parts are available before maintenance activities begin. Track work order progress and adjust schedules as needed to accommodate unforeseen issues. Maintain accurate records of completed maintenance tasks, failure analysis, and improvement actions. Ensure all maintenance work is performed in compliance with OSHA regulations, company safety policies, and industry standards. Coordinate maintenance activities with safety teams to ensure a safe working environment. Collaborate with operations production specialists to define and prioritize maintenance and vendor support. Collaborate with engineering to support and maintain the maintenance work schedule. Maintain documentation and records required for audits and regulatory compliance. Act as a liaison between maintenance, production, and engineering teams to align maintenance activities with business goals. Communicate maintenance schedules and work plans to relevant stakeholders. Provide reports on maintenance KPIs, including downtime, work order completion rates, and cost metrics. Develop and refine preventive maintenance (PM) programs to enhance equipment reliability and longevity. Work with reliability engineers to implement predictive maintenance (PdM) strategies using condition monitoring tools such as vibration analysis, infrared thermography, and oil analysis. Ensure compliance with industry standards and best practices for maintenance strategies. Requirements
High school diploma or equivalent OR Associate’s or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, Maintenance Management, or a related field. Minimum 3–5 years of maintenance planning experience in a high-volume manufacturing environment. Strong knowledge of CMMS systems (e.g., SAP PM, Maximo, Infor EAM, Fiix). Familiarity with industrial equipment, including mechanical, electrical, pneumatic, and hydraulic systems. Ability to read and interpret technical drawings, schematics, and P&IDs. Strong problem-solving skills and the ability to prioritize tasks efficiently. Excellent organizational, communication, and teamwork skills. Nice to have: Certification in Maintenance Planning & Scheduling (e.g., SMRP, CMRP, or PMP). Experience with Lean Manufacturing, Six Sigma, or Reliability-Centered Maintenance (RCM) principles. Understanding of industry regulations such as OSHA, NFPA, and ANSI. Physical Demands and Working Conditions
Pass a respirator fit test and be able to wear respiratory protection on a daily basis. Wear personal protective equipment including, but not limited to, a lab coat, gloves, safety glasses, and steel toe safety shoes. Move items up to 50 lbs with the assistance of lift equipment and carts. Move long distances and be stationary for extended periods of time. Reach low shelves or items on the floor. Enter spaces narrower than 3 feet. Climb stairs or over containment walls. Precise and repetitive handling of a range of material quantities. Operate a computer and other office equipment in a fixed location. Compensation
The starting base pay for this role is between $92,000 and $125,000 at the time of posting. The actual base pay depends on education, experience, and skills. Base pay is only one part of Sila’s Total Rewards package that can include benefits, perks, equity, and bonuses. The base pay range is subject to change and may be modified in the future.
